Imagine waking up to a website that’s not just functional but also stunning, drawing visitors in like moths to a flame. You don’t have to be a tech wizard to achieve this; all you need is the right WordPress installation service. Have you ever felt overwhelmed by the endless plugins, themes, and settings? You’re not alone.
Consider how much time you’d save if someone else handled the heavy lifting for you. Picture your site running smoothly, optimized for speed and performance, while you focus on what truly matters: your content and audience. A professional WordPress installation service can transform this vision into reality, offering benefits that go beyond mere convenience. From enhanced security features to seamless updates, you’ll wonder why you didn’t take this step sooner.
Overview of WordPress Installation Services
WordPress installation services ensure that your website is set up correctly, efficiently, and securely. These services save you time and reduce the risk of errors, making them invaluable for both beginners and experienced users.
Why Consider Professional Installation?
Professional installation eliminates the complexity of setting up WordPress. Experts handle everything from database configuration to theme installation, ensuring optimal performance. For instance, while you focus on crafting engaging content, professionals configure security settings to protect your site from potential threats.
Consider the scenario where a novice tries to install WordPress independently. Missteps in configuring essential plugins could lead to vulnerabilities or performance issues. In contrast, professionals possess the expertise to avoid these pitfalls, providing peace of mind.
Additionally, professional services often include ongoing support. This means if any issues arise post-installation, you have access to immediate assistance rather than sifting through forums for solutions.
Types of Services Offered
WordPress installation services offer various options tailored to different needs:
- Basic Installation: Includes setting up WordPress on your hosting provider with essential configurations.
- Theme Customization: Professionals install and customize themes according to your brand’s aesthetic.
- Plugin Setup: Experts select and configure plugins critical for functionality like SEO (e.g., Yoast SEO), security (e.g., Wordfence), and performance (e.g., WP Rocket).
- Security Enhancements: Implementation of security measures such as SSL certificates and regular malware scans.
- Performance Optimization: Techniques like caching setup and image optimization are employed for faster load times.
For example, a service might offer basic installation alongside premium options like custom theme development or eCommerce integration via WooCommerce.
Investing in professional WordPress installation ensures your website is robust from the start, allowing you to focus on growth without technical distractions.
Choosing the Right WordPress Installation Service
Selecting the right WordPress installation service ensures your website operates efficiently and securely. Focus on key factors to make an informed choice.
Evaluation Criteria
When evaluating services, consider expertise, reputation, and customer support. Ensure the service has a proven track record with client testimonials and case studies. Assess their experience with themes, plugins, and security measures.
- Expertise: Look for certified professionals or agencies with extensive experience in WordPress installations. Verify their knowledge of the latest WordPress updates.
- Reputation: Check reviews on platforms like Trustpilot or G2. Positive feedback from previous clients indicates reliability.
- Customer Support: Ensure they offer ongoing support post-installation. Prompt assistance resolves issues quickly.
Recommendations and Reviews
Recommendations from peers or online communities provide valuable insights. Seek advice from those who’ve used similar services to understand potential benefits and drawbacks.
- Peer Recommendations: Ask colleagues or industry contacts about their experiences with specific services.
- Online Reviews: Platforms like Reddit, Quora, or specialized forums often have threads discussing various WordPress installation services.
- Expert Opinions: Follow recommendations from reputable tech blogs or WordPress influencers who regularly review these services.
Choosing wisely based on these criteria guarantees a smooth setup process for your website.
The Installation Process Explained
Installing WordPress can seem daunting, but breaking it down into steps simplifies the process. Follow these steps to ensure a smooth installation.
Step-by-Step Installation
- Download WordPress: Obtain the latest version from WordPress.org. This ensures you’re working with the most recent updates and security features.
- Create a Database: Access your web hosting control panel, usually cPanel or a similar interface. Navigate to MySQL Databases and create a new database with an associated user.
- Upload Files: Use an FTP client like FileZilla to upload WordPress files to your server’s public_html directory. Alternatively, some hosts offer one-click installers that simplify this process.
- Configure wp-config.php: Locate the
wp-config-sample.php
file in your WordPress directory, rename it towp-config.php
, then edit it with your database details. - Run the Installer: Open your browser and navigate to your domain name. You’ll be prompted to complete the installation by providing site information like title, username, password, and email address.
Customizations and Setup
Once WordPress is installed, customize it to suit your needs:
- Choose a Theme: Select from thousands of free and premium themes available in the WordPress theme repository or third-party sites like ThemeForest.
- Install Essential Plugins: Enhance functionality by installing plugins for SEO (like Yoast SEO), security (like Wordfence), and performance (like WP Super Cache).
- Configure Settings: Navigate to the settings section in your dashboard to configure general settings such as site title, tagline, timezone, and permalink structure for SEO-friendly URLs.
- Create Pages and Posts: Start adding content by creating pages for static content (About Us, Contact) and posts for dynamic content (blog articles).
- Set Up Navigation Menus: Organize your site’s structure by setting up navigation menus under Appearance > Menus in the dashboard.
- Optimize for Security: Implement security measures such as using strong passwords, enabling two-factor authentication, and regularly updating themes/plugins.
By following these steps meticulously, you ensure not only a successful installation but also a well-optimized website ready for visitors.
Common Challenges and Solutions
WordPress installation often presents various challenges. However, understanding these issues can ensure a smooth setup process.
Troubleshooting Common Issues
Several common issues arise during WordPress installation:
- Database Connection Errors: Encountering a “Error establishing a database connection” message can be frustrating. This typically occurs due to incorrect database credentials. Double-check the
wp-config.php
file for accurate database name, username, password, and host details. Ensure your database server is running if the problem persists. - File Permission Problems: Incorrect file permissions can prevent WordPress from accessing necessary files and directories. To resolve this, set the correct permissions using an FTP client or hosting control panel. For instance, set directories to
755
and files to644
. - Memory Limit Exhaustion: Sometimes WordPress consumes more memory than allocated by your server. To fix this, increase the PHP memory limit by adding
define('WP_MEMORY_LIMIT', '64M');
in thewp-config.php
file. - Plugin Conflicts: Installed plugins might conflict with each other or with WordPress core files, causing errors or performance issues. Deactivate all plugins and reactivate them one by one to identify the culprit.
- Theme Compatibility Issues: Not all themes are compatible with every version of WordPress or with other plugins you use. If a theme causes your site to crash or behave unexpectedly, switch back to a default theme like Twenty Twenty-One and troubleshoot further from there.
Preventive Measures and Best Practices
Implementing preventive measures ensures fewer disruptions during your WordPress journey:
- Regular Backups: Regularly back up your website files and databases using plugins like UpdraftPlus or BackupBuddy. This ensures you can restore your site quickly if anything goes wrong.
- Update Management: Keep WordPress core, themes, and plugins updated to their latest versions to avoid security vulnerabilities and compatibility issues.
- Security Enhancements: Enhance security by installing security plugins such as Wordfence Security or Sucuri Security that offer firewall protection and malware scanning.
- Strong Credentials: Use strong passwords for your admin account and database users to prevent unauthorized access.
- Staging Environment: Use a staging environment for testing new themes, plugins, or updates before applying them on your live site to avoid potential downtime or conflicts.
By addressing these common challenges proactively through troubleshooting methods and preventive practices you ensure a stable WordPress installation that functions smoothly over time.
Key Takeaways
- Time-Saving and Efficiency: Professional WordPress installation services save you time and reduce the risk of errors, allowing you to focus on creating content and engaging with your audience.
- Enhanced Security: Experts handle security configurations, ensuring your website is protected from potential threats right from the start.
- Comprehensive Service Options: Services range from basic installations to theme customization, plugin setup, security enhancements, and performance optimization.
- Ongoing Support: Many services offer ongoing support post-installation, providing immediate assistance for any issues that arise.
- Choosing the Right Service: Evaluating expertise, reputation, and customer support ensures you select a reliable WordPress installation service tailored to your needs.
- Troubleshooting and Best Practices: Understanding common installation challenges and implementing preventive measures like regular backups and update management ensures a stable and secure WordPress site.
Conclusion
Choosing a professional WordPress installation service can save you time and enhance your site’s security. By following the detailed steps and addressing common challenges, you’ll ensure a smooth and efficient installation process. Remember to implement preventive measures like regular backups and updates to maintain a stable WordPress environment. With the right approach, you can focus on creating quality content while enjoying a reliable and secure website.
Frequently Asked Questions
Why should I opt for professional WordPress installation services?
Professional WordPress installation services save you time and ensure enhanced security. Experts handle the technical details, reducing the risk of errors and vulnerabilities.
How do I choose the right WordPress installation service?
Select a service based on expertise and reputation. Look for reviews, testimonials, and their portfolio to assess their experience and reliability.
What are the basic steps to install WordPress manually?
The basic steps include downloading WordPress, creating a database, uploading files, configuring settings, and customizing with themes and plugins.
What should I do if I encounter a database connection error during installation?
Check your database credentials (hostname, username, password), ensure the database server is running, and verify that the user has proper permissions.
How can I fix file permission issues in WordPress?
Adjust file permissions via FTP or your hosting control panel. Typically, directories should have 755 permissions and files 644 permissions.
What is memory limit exhaustion in WordPress, and how can I resolve it?
Memory limit exhaustion occurs when PHP scripts exceed allocated memory. Increase memory limits by editing your wp-config.php
file or contacting your host.
How can plugin conflicts be resolved during WordPress installation?
Deactivate all plugins and reactivate them one by one to identify the conflicting plugin. Ensure all plugins are updated to their latest versions.
What should be done if a theme is not compatible with my WordPress version?
Ensure you are using an up-to-date theme compatible with your current WordPress version. Check for theme updates or consider switching to a different theme.
What preventive measures can be taken for a stable WordPress site?
Regularly backup your site, keep software updated, enhance security measures, use strong credentials, and utilize staging environments for testing changes before going live.